Undiscovered gem of a hotel near San Pedro.
Pros: We were looking for a place on the lower end of the price spectrum that was a one night romantic getaway for two, that I could also use my free trip coins at toward the cost of the room. Preferably including breakfast and a swimming pool with jacuzzi 😉 Not much to ask!
We booked one of the cheaper rooms on the ground floor.
Before check in we took an Uber to San Pedro mall to do some essential shopping and see a movie. Then we checked in and I relaxed in the jacuzzi under the San José night sky while my husband enjoyed a full workout in the gym/weights room. TV with cable was great for my husband who enjoyed the football while I enjoyed the hot shower and relaxed in the bed afterwards. We had an amazingly comfortable sleep and a delicious breakfast in the morning of gallo pinto, fresh tropical fruits, freshly squeezed watermelon juice and hot coffee. A generous check out time of 12pm meant we had more than enough time to get our things together and leave when it suited.
Cons: Not many cons at this price point and value. The guy at the desk was a bit weird when we asked him for a second glass for water as there was only one in the room but not a big deal. We also had to ask him for the TV remote. The towels were a bit small like a mini dress on me after my shower. But good quality (with a third extra towel for the jacuzzi) and high quality bed linen. It also is in a slightly rough looking neighborhood but this is not a problem if you travel to and from the hotel by Uber or use a hire car (which you can park privately inside the property).
Overall impression: The other photos on trip.com and similar booking sites do not do this hotel justice - it looks far better in person. It has real character since it is a restored historic hotel from an era bygone, but that is why everything is such high quality from the bed linen to the floor tiles. Everything is also in good shape and freshly painted. There a little hidden nooks around the hotel that make it very charming. The breakfast area is lovely and the jacuzzi, pool and water slide were a real highlight. We WILL be back.

Sunny DarkKing room with city view, 14 floor: 2 nights. July
* You will hear the music from the bar across the park until 3am. Not much noises from the regular city streets.
* No fresh air available in this hotel. All the windows are sealed.
* No fridge, no Netflix. But plenty of english channels on tv.
* good internet.
* excellent hot water, and water pressure.
* small gym ok, but no windows, and tv was not working.
* nice indoor pool, but water too cold for me. No windows but a clear dome.
* breakfast have ok choices, not much for a vegetarian.
* restaurant expensive like any other hotel, but the staff is sympathic.
* free parking.
* very nice staff.
* reservation with Trip.com was a complication, they didn't have my reservation. Took 1h to check-in. At the check-out they charged me the room that was already paid on Trip.com, had to ask for a refund, which they did, no arguying but a lot of explanations and proof of payment... but the staff was really polite and helpful.
* only 1 person working at the counter for check-in and check-out..
* easy to walk everywhere.
* easy to navigate with google map or waze.

It's a decent hotel with a lot of details that aren't quite right. The rooms are comfortable and the beds are excellent. The maid didn't empty the trash cans during our two-night stay, nor was the shampoo ever refilled in the dispenser in the shower. There are no carpets or rugs in the room so you're constantly walking on luxury vinyl plank flooring with wet feet. After you get out of the shower. There are no Kleenex boxes or dispensers in the room, and the TV programming was difficult to decipher, especially the secondary audio program in order to listen to the TV in English rather than Spanish. Also, the closed captioning never worked on the TV

The hotel is half an hour away from the airport. The rooms are large and clean. It provides the famous local Britt coffee. The breakfast variety is OK, and it changes every day. The waiter will enthusiastically pour coffee or orange juice. However, some single rooms may have a connecting door next door. If you mind, you can inform the front desk in advance.
